Transaction 5e25146c341b93f7de45fba90db7eeac26d708161bc158a3793e7bf058dee5ac
1 Input
1 Output
-
5e25146c341b93f7de45fba90db7eeac26d708161bc158a3793e7bf058dee5ac:0
- value
- 570273
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 28b922db771bf11af3f77c75bed749591363c3b4 OP_EQUAL
- address
- 35QLjhj39XSwJV7w9DaUSJ3jFTqZwGhMsy